Login  |  Register

Organic wear® 100% Natural Origin Mascara

Organic wear® 100% Natural Origin Mascara; Organic wear® 100% Natural Origin Mascara. Rating: 84 % of 100. 36 Reviews Add Your Review. $9.95. In stock. SKU. …

Alexa Traffic